Sell Your Stuff Online

You probably have stuff at home you don’t use—clothes, gadgets, or books. With apps like eBay, Poshmark, or Facebook Marketplace, you can take a quick photo and list it fast. All you need is your phone, some light, and a clear description.

Become a Mobile Freelancer

Are you good at writing, editing, or design? You can use apps like Fiverr or Upwork to offer your skills. Just make a profile, list what you do, and talk to clients from your phone. You can even do voice work if your mic is clear. It’s like having a tiny studio in your pocket.

Take Surveys and Earn Rewards

Let’s be real. Survey sites won’t make you rich. But they can earn you quick gift cards or small cash rewards during downtime. Apps like Swagbucks, InboxDollars, and Google Opinion Rewards are easy to use. Just be selective. Avoid scams, and stick with reputable names.

Flip Thrift Finds

Some folks have a sharp eye for deals. If you’re one of them, this hustles for you. Go to thrift stores or garage sales. Use your phone to check prices online. If an item sells for more, buy it and resell it through apps like Mercari or OfferUp. It’s fun and can be surprisingly profitable.

Offer Local Services

Think about what people in your neighborhood need. Dog walking? Babysitting? Lawn care? Use community apps like Nextdoor or Craigslist to offer your services. Post a quick ad with your phone and start small. Local gigs often pay cash and build long-term relationships.

Review Apps and Websites

Companies need feedback. They want to know what users think. Apps like UserTesting and TryMyUI pay people to test websites and apps. You’ll record your thoughts as you go. A quiet space and a smartphone are all you need. Some tests pay up to $10 for 10 minutes.

Make and Sell Digital Products

With design apps like Canva and Adobe Express, you can create digital products right from your phone. Think planners, Instagram templates, or printable art. List them on Etsy or Gumroad. Once it’s up, you earn money while you sleep. It’s passive income at its best.

Become a Virtual Assistant

Busy people need help. Entrepreneurs, real estate agents, and influencers all outsource small tasks. Responding to emails, scheduling meetings, or managing social media can be done entirely from a phone. Websites like Belay, Fancy Hands, or even LinkedIn are great places to start.

Voiceover Work or Audiobook Reading

You don’t need a studio to get into voice work. A quiet space, a good voice, and a decent microphone app are enough. Record short demos on your phone. Share them on sites like Voices.com or ACX. If your tone fits, you’ll get hired. It’s fun and flexible.
